Frankie Hejduk Slapped By Paco Ramirez After USA vs Mexico Match
by Jon Azpiri | February 12, 2009 at 10:47 am
1913 views | 0 Recommendations | 6 comments
US defender Frankie Hejduk was slapped by Mexican assistant coach Paco Ramirez after the a 2-0 US victory at Columbus Crew Stadium.
The incident occurred as the two teams were walking off the pitch. According to Hejduk, he was cheering "F--k yeah!" after winning the game, but Ramirez thought he was saying "F--k you!" and slapped him.
The incident is yet another incident between the two teams, who have one of the most heated in rivalries in sports.
Hejduk was forgiving after the event, and said that Ramirez only gave him a "love tap."
